Building Information Modeling (BIM) has revolutionized the construction industry by providing a digital representation of the physical and functional characteristics of a building Information model BIM plays a crucial role in enhancing collaboration, communication, and decision-making throughout the lifecycle of a construction project.
BIM is a 3D model-based process that enables architects, engineers, and construction professionals to work together more efficiently and effectively By integrating information model BIM into the design and construction phases of a project, stakeholders can visualize the entire building before it is built, identify potential issues, and make informed decisions that will ultimately save time and money.
One of the key advantages of information model BIM is its ability to centralize project information and data in a single, shared model This allows all parties involved in the project to access accurate and up-to-date information, reducing the risk of errors and misunderstandings With information model BIM, changes made to the design are automatically updated throughout the model, ensuring that everyone is working from the same source of truth.
Furthermore, information model BIM can improve the coordination and communication between different disciplines involved in a construction project By combining 3D models with scheduling and cost data, project teams can identify clashes, conflicts, or discrepancies early in the design phase, preventing costly revisions and delays during construction This integrated approach also enables stakeholders to simulate different scenarios, evaluate design options, and optimize the building’s performance.
In addition to enhancing collaboration and coordination, information model BIM can provide valuable insights for project management and decision-making By linking the 3D model with project information such as schedules, costs, and materials, stakeholders can better estimate the time and resources required for each phase of the project information model bim. This allows for more accurate budgeting, scheduling, and resource allocation, ultimately improving the overall efficiency and profitability of the project.
Moreover, information model BIM can facilitate the exchange of data and information between different software applications and systems used in the design and construction processes By using open standards and protocols, such as Industry Foundation Classes (IFC) and COBie, BIM models can be easily shared and integrated with other software tools, allowing for seamless collaboration and data exchange between stakeholders throughout the project lifecycle.
Another key benefit of information model BIM is its potential for improving the sustainability and performance of buildings By incorporating energy analysis, daylighting simulations, and other performance metrics into the BIM model, designers can optimize the building’s performance, reduce energy consumption, and enhance occupant comfort This holistic approach to building design and construction not only benefits the environment but also adds value to the project by increasing its long-term efficiency and sustainability.
